A Day in the Life Designation: Product Manager - Stent Portfolio (Pan India) Function: Marketing Location: Mumbai, India Position Summary The Product Manager will be responsible for driving the overall marketing strat-egy, business growth, and execution of the Stent Portfolio across India. This role will lead strategic marketing initiatives, product positioning, market development programs, physician education activities, and commercial execution. The incumbent will work closely with Sales, Clinical, Compliance, Medical Education, Market Access and Commercial Excellence teams while engaging extensively with Key Opinion Leaders (KOLs) across India. Key Responsibilities - Develop and execute annual marketing plans for the Stent Portfolio across India. - Drive market development initiatives and portfolio growth strategies. - Lead product launches, lifecycle management, forecasting, and portfolio reviews. - Build strong relationships with leading cardiologists, interventional cardiologists, and healthcare institutions. - Design and execute KOL engagement programs, workshops, symposia and scientific initiatives. - Collaborate closely with Sales, Clinical, Medical Affairs and Compliance teams. - Develop promotional campaigns, physician education programs and sales enablement tools. - Monitor market trends, competitor activity, and customer insights to identify growth opportunities. - Manage marketing budgets and assess ROI marketing initiatives.
